          ORDER MODIFYING SCHEDULE

          OLIVER W. WANGER, District Judge.

         Plaintiff United States of America requests a continuance of the hearing on the United States' motion for summary judgment. The Clingenpeels, taxpayers and defendants here, have submitted amended tax returns which may avoid the need to adjudicate some issues in this case. The Clingenpeels do not oppose this request to continue. Counsel for the United States believes that any remaining issues will be resolved by the pending motions.

         Upon good cause shown,

         IT IS ORDERED THAT

         The hearing on the United States' motion for summary judgment and motion for entry of default judgment (Doc. No. 27, ), is continued to July 11, 2011, at 10:00 a.m. in Courtroom 3.

         IT IS SO ORDERED.
